Garantia de qualidade de software com ênfase em testes de software
Carregando...
Data
Autores
Título da Revista
ISSN da Revista
Título de Volume
Editor
004
Resumo
Esta monografia tem por objetivo detalhar como é aplicada a qualidade no processo de desenvolvimento de um software, desde o seu surgimento como disciplina na Engenharia de Software até a sua evolução com o aprimoramento das atividades de teste.
No início do desenvolvimento de softwares, os testes tinham por objetivo principal mostrar que o produto desenvolvido estava livre de erros, ou seja, em conformidade com os requisitos especificados no início do projeto. Com a evolução no processo de qualidade de software, os testes passaram a ter como objetivo principal o oposto de quando se iniciou: identificar o maior número possível de erros, a fim de tornar o software confiável e de acordo com as especificações definidas no projeto.
Este trabalho abordará conceitos de qualidade, estratégias de testes e quais são os momentos adequados para se utilizar cada uma delas. Também tratará dos profissionais responsáveis pela execução das atividades de testes, e todo o processo de documentação envolvido, com a finalidade de adequar o projeto a cada uma das etapas envolvidas, resultando em um produto que se comporte de acordo com o que foi especificado.
The purpose of this Monograph is to detail with how quality is applied in software development process. From its appearance as a Software Engineering discipline up to its evolution with tests and activities enhancement. In the beginning of software development, the tests purpose was to show that the developed product was free of bugs. As the software quality process evolved, the tests purpose changes totally and actually now the task is identifying the greater amount of possible bugs to make the final product more reliable. This helped software produced to be more reliable in conformity with previous defined project specifications. This work will approach quality concepts, tests strategies and when will it be more appropriate to use each of them. It will also approach the professionals involved in these activities and the entire documentation process to make sure all phases of the project will contribute to the results and will be in accordance with the project specifications.
The purpose of this Monograph is to detail with how quality is applied in software development process. From its appearance as a Software Engineering discipline up to its evolution with tests and activities enhancement. In the beginning of software development, the tests purpose was to show that the developed product was free of bugs. As the software quality process evolved, the tests purpose changes totally and actually now the task is identifying the greater amount of possible bugs to make the final product more reliable. This helped software produced to be more reliable in conformity with previous defined project specifications. This work will approach quality concepts, tests strategies and when will it be more appropriate to use each of them. It will also approach the professionals involved in these activities and the entire documentation process to make sure all phases of the project will contribute to the results and will be in accordance with the project specifications.
Descrição
Citação
PERIN, Flávia. Garantia de qualidade de software com ênfase em testes de software, 2006. Trabalho de Conclusão de Curso (Curso Superior de Tecnologia em Processamento de Dados) - Faculdade de Tecnologia de Americana, Americana, 2006.